Strategic Capital Structure: Equity and Debt Synergy
Metaguest.AI's capital structure reflects a blend of equity and debt financing, tailored to fuel operational expansion while managing risk. In February 2024, the company executed a private placement offering, issuing 312,550 units at $0.30 per unit, generating $93,765 in gross proceeds[1]. Each unit included one common share and one-half of a warrant, with the warrant exercisable at $0.50 per share until October 2025[1]. This structure not only provided immediate liquidity but also created a mechanism for future equity dilution, aligning investor incentives with long-term value creation.
By November 2023, cumulative proceeds from this offering had reached $403,799, primarily earmarked for working capital[1]. A subsequent $3.1 million friends-and-family funding round in fall 2024 further solidified the company's financial runway, supporting operations until late 2025[2]. These equity raises highlight Metaguest.AI's ability to attract early-stage capital, particularly from aligned stakeholders, to sustain its growth narrative.
On the debt side, the company has tapped into secured loan facilities to diversify its funding sources. In September 2025, Metaguest.AI closed an additional $224,000 tranche under a $1,000,000 secured loan facility, bringing total proceeds to $417,000[1]. The facility carries a 12% annual interest rate and a 12% loan advance fee, paid in shares[1]. While the high-interest rate introduces financial risk, the secured nature of the loan—backed by the company's assets—mitigates lender exposure, making it a viable option for short-term liquidity. The proceeds are explicitly directed toward working capital, underscoring the company's focus on scaling operations[1].
Market Positioning: AI-Driven Hospitality Disruption
Metaguest.AI's strategic financing is closely tied to its market positioning as a disruptor in the AI hospitality sector. The company's digital guest engagement ecosystem addresses critical pain points in the industry, including operational inefficiencies and fragmented guest experiences. By automating concierge services, streamlining enterprise workflows, and optimizing supply chains, Metaguest.AI aims to reduce costs while enhancing guest satisfaction[2].
The company's traction is evident in its client base: 310 hotels are already on its platform, with 700 on the waitlist[2]. This pipeline positions Metaguest.AI to achieve its ambitious target of 3,000 hotels by the end of 2026[2]. Such growth is not merely speculative; it is supported by a multi-phase revenue model that includes subscription-based services for digital concierge tools, enterprise automation solutions, and supply chain optimization[2].

Risk and Reward: Balancing Aggressive Growth with Financial Prudence
While Metaguest.AI's capital strategy is aggressive, it is not without risks. The reliance on high-interest debt—particularly the 12% secured loan facility—could strain cash flow if revenue growth does not outpace borrowing costs. Additionally, the company's heavy focus on equity dilution (via warrants and loan advance fees paid in shares) may dilute existing shareholders' ownership over time.
However, these risks are counterbalanced by the company's strong market positioning and scalable business model.
